Mexico, the United States, and Peru are the top global fresh avocado exporters, with Mexico dominating the market through large-scale production and efficient export logistics. The U.S. leads in premium, high-quality avocados, while Peru is a key player in the global supply chain, especially for bulk wholesale and export to Europe and Asia. These countries form the core of the world’s leading avocado supply, serving major B2B buyers with consistent quality and volume. To find reliable fresh avocado suppliers, use trusted B2B platforms like Alibaba, Global Sources, and Freshdi.com to access direct manufacturers. Prioritize suppliers with HACCP, ISO 22000, and GAP certifications to ensure food safety and compliance. Key attributes to check include ripeness consistency, shelf life, pesticide residue, and packaging integrity. Always request product samples and verify export history. Confirm wholesale pricing with transparent MOQs and delivery terms. Secure payments via Letter of Credit or Trade Assurance. Conduct factory audits or on-site visits to validate production capacity and quality control processes before finalizing sourcing agreements.
To source bulk fresh avocado wholesale, start by identifying verified manufacturers with import compliance certifications (e.g., ISO 22000, HACCP) and verified supplier status. Specify your volume, delivery frequency, and quality requirements (e.g., size, ripeness, shelf life) in your Request for Quotation (RFQ). Negotiate terms like FOB shipping, Trade Assurance, or Letters of Credit to ensure secure payment and logistics. Confirm cold chain compliance to maintain freshness during transit. The standard MOQ for wholesale fresh avocado ranges from 500 to 1,000 units (approx. 200–400 lbs) for commercial orders, with larger distributors requiring 20ft container loads (up to 1,500 lbs) to optimize shipping and refrigeration costs. Smaller buyers, such as restaurants or food service providers, may find flexible MOQs starting at 100–200 units through direct bulk suppliers. Direct farm-to-distributor agreements often offer lower thresholds due to reduced logistics overhead, while private-label or branded avocado products typically require 500+ units to cover packaging and quality control costs. Always verify freshness standards and temperature control requirements for commercial orders.
